Airhog 10-03-2003 10:13 PM

17yo solid playmakers are more expensive at the start of the season. if he was low, you could possibly train him to formidable if you skipped the offseason stamina training. I would rather wait and take a passable 17yo with secondaries at the start of the season....

sterlingice 10-03-2003 11:25 PM

He's a just bumped solid, FYI. Pay what you'd pay for a high passable.
